Action Language Hybrid AL
Abstract
This paper introduces Hybrid AL, an extension of the action
language AL that allows to reason about actions and their consequences
for the domains where such consequences can be described practically
only as results of the computations by exetrnal algorithms. While the
semantics of the action language AL is defined using ASP, the semantics
of the action language Hybrid AL is defined using Hybrid ASP -
an extension of ASP allowing rules to control sequential processing of
arbitrary binary data by external algorithms.
